Megan Renee Phillips, 25, of Seaman, passed away on Thursday, Oct. 26, 2017.
She was born in Dayton on July 1, 1992, the daughter of Brian (Sarah) Phillips of Seaman and Loretta Phillips of Middletown. Megan was preceded in death by her cousin, Lindsey Pearson.
Besides her parents, Megan is survived by her brothers, Specialist Josh Moore of Texas and Drew Coppock of Seaman; three sisters, Tosha Phillips, Carly Phillips and Madison Phillips all of Seaman; boyfriend, Donavan Gallaway of McDermott; four cousins, Molly and Danielle Miller, Michael and TJ Pearson; maternal grandparents, Barb and Art Purdue; paternal grandmother, Martha Glenn; and step-grandparents, Mauree and Bob Armbrust; and several aunts, uncles, and friends.
Megan was a beautiful soul who will live on through her family and friends.
Services will be 3 p.m. Wednesday, Nov. 1 at the Wallace-Thompson Lewis-Sullivan Funeral Home in Seaman.
Friends may call from 1 p.m. until time of services on Wednesday at the funeral home.
